Abstract
High resolution CT (HRCT) is currently the most accurate non-invasive modality for evaluating the lung parenchyma. The cross-sectional perspective and high spatial resolution make HRCT superior to other imaging modalities. HRCT can also be used in the evaluation of pulmonary tuberculosis (TR). Here we describe a case of active pulmonary TR evaluated by HRCT.
